Bamboo vs Carbonised Bamboo: Which Chopping Board Wins for UK Home Cooks?

If you cook at home in the UK 4 or more times a week and want one main board for daily prep, a carbonised bamboo chopping board usually wins, because its heat treated surface is slightly more water resistant and can last 1 to 2 years longer under the same use than natural bamboo. For lighter use of 2 to 3 meals a week, a standard bamboo board will give you 5 to 10 years of service with proper care and better value for money. How to Care for Bamboo Chopping Boards to Keep Them Hygienic and Beautiful?

If you want to know how to care for bamboo chopping boards to keep them hygienic and beautiful, the answer is simple: wash by hand within 10 minutes of use, dry upright for at least 30 minutes, and oil them every 3 to 4 weeks. Follow that routine and a quality board like the Deer & Oak Large Bamboo Board can stay smooth, safe and good looking for 5 to 10 years of regular cooking.
